Revision as of Jun 22, 2025, 6:29:39 PM
Croton May 1887
Tue May 3 rd clear and hot, we were plowing the corn ground. William {ampersand?} yohn Saw was hawling out manure parpair ing a piece of ground for corn that was Sowed with fall wheat and the wire {woruns?} eat it out. Wed May 4 th clear most of the day and warm were plowing this fore noon, after noon i went to Dresden. Thu May 5 th cloud and cool. I was wheeling out and spreading manure, Walter was plowing Fri May 6 th clear and hot, the thermomiter Reg 80 deg. in the shade, finished plowing the field for corn East of the barns Sat May 7 th clear part of the day and hot. I was transplanting Strawberry vines. Walter was harrowing corn ground. Sun May 8 th cloudy part of the day and hot
Croton May 1887
Mon May 9 th clear most of the day and hot, Walter finished harrowing the corn ground. I was repairing bars and gates in the fore noon afternoon pileing manure, peach plum {ampersand?} cherry
